Output 1ddc58f6022c46a7eda95af99e62d659da6d80e048cb5e96a89774482787e780:0

value
686692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ab153d7e07a6c86989554e975766edd4f2467a1 OP_EQUAL
address
3FnxR1xCgEwxEfRewkhxXPK61d2jiuAFXK
transaction
1ddc58f6022c46a7eda95af99e62d659da6d80e048cb5e96a89774482787e780
spent
false